For your Bio 264 class you will need to use the CSE citation style that can be found on the CSE manual website. This style is similar to APA but has some small differences. 

If you use an auto-generated APA citation from Zotero, a database, or another source, always compare the citation to the examples below and make adjustments to ensure the style is followed correctly.

Articles

Journal titles are generally abbreviated according to the List of Title Word Abbreviations maintained by the ISSN International Centre.

Basic Scholarly Journal Article Citation

Author(s). Date. Article title. Journal title. Volume(issue):location.

Example: Mazan MR, Hoffman AM. 2001. Effects of aerosolized albuterol on physiologic responses to exercise in standardbreds. Am J Vet Res. 62(11):1812–1817.

(Mazan and Hoffman 2001)

Journal Article with three to ten authors

Example: Smart N, Fang ZY, Marwick TH. 2003. A practical guide to exercise training for heart failure patients. J Card Fail. 9(1):49–58.

(Smart et al. 2003)
